How do you describe an internship experience on a resume?

Here’s how to put an internship on a resume:

  • Make sure your internship is relevant to the position you’re after.
  • List your internship in the professional experience section of your resume.
  • Specify what kind of internship you had in the job title.
  • List the company name, dates, and location.

What is an ideal internship?

The Ideal Internship – An ideal internship is one that offers the student a progressively challenging work experience, supported by an organization that provides solid orientation, training, supervision, and feedback.

What should I wear on my first day of internship?

A good rule of thumb is to avoid extremes in terms of clothing, accessories, and perfume.

  • For the women: Women should make sure that skirts aren’t too short, slacks aren’t too tight, and necklines aren’t too low.
  • For the men: Men should wear a neutral shirt (white is always a safe bet) with a tie.
